Form 4: Graham Corp CEO Matthew Malone Reports Stock Vesting
Statement of Changes in Beneficial Ownership
CEO Matthew Malone acquired 8,619 shares of Graham Corporation common stock following the vesting of performance-based restricted stock units.
Summary
- Matthew Malone, President and CEO of Graham Corporation, acquired 8,619 shares of common stock on June 8, 2026, upon the vesting of performance-based restricted stock units (PSUs).
- A total of 2,477 shares were withheld by the company to satisfy tax obligations related to the vesting event.
- Following these transactions, Mr. Malone's total beneficial ownership of Graham Corporation common stock is 63,629 shares.
- The vesting of the PSUs was based on the achievement of pre-determined performance measures over a three-year period ending March 31, 2026.
